Post by HUSH on Oct 20, 2006 17:15:49 GMT -5
The problem with the DCSH wave 1 Batman is that although it is a retool of Batsignal Batman, the rubber cape causes some problems that Batsignal Batman didn't have, most notably, and unfortunate, is that it makes his ball-jointed neck joint a cut joint instead, and forces him to be looking down at the ground all the time. Not to mention he doesn't come with the awesome Batsignal accessory. Of course, if those things are okay with you, buy all means, get the DCSH 1 Batman. Otherwise, I got my Batsignal Bats off eBay a while back, and I think that's gonna be your only possibility, although I don't know how fruitful it will be now, if at all. But maybe you'll get lucky and find one for an okay price. Good luck to you if you decide to continue pursuing this fig. And if you can't find Batsignal Batman, or don't want to go through all the trouble trying, I feel that DCSH wave 3 Batman, a new sculpt, and for the most part out right now, is the best Batman there is, so you can look into him as well. He should be easier to find, at any rate.
